A new year is a good time to set new goals for yourself, and many of those goals revolve around fitness. However, it’s well known that New Year’s resolutions aren’t always effective – a very large number of them fail every year. If you’re thinking about setting fitness-related resolutions for yourself this year, what you need to do is learn how to stick to an exercise routine like a pro. Listen in to hear Josh and James discuss why New Year’s resolutions fail, why you have a better chance of success if you start with simple habits, and why you should focus more on ritual than on results.
